Skip to product information
1 of 1

HEMDALE - Can You Smell The Stench??? Double CD , Slipcase

HEMDALE - Can You Smell The Stench??? Double CD , Slipcase

Regular price £17.00
Regular price Sale price £17.00
Sale Sold out
Tax included.

Distro Item - Import

View full details